Software Developer Apprentice

About Chemistry Marketing:

We’re a dynamic (some say ‘explosive’) multi-disciplinary creative agency based in Newcastle upon Tyne. From the very start we’ve specialised in both offline and online marketing, fusing creativity, digital expertise and insightful data-driven strategies. Why? So that we can create and deliver positive reactions through compelling communications that work for your business.

About the role:

We are looking for an enthusiastic apprentice who is passionate about web development and eager to develop their technical skills. You will support the development and maintenance of WordPress websites while learning core software development practices including coding standards, version control, testing, and deployment.

You will work alongside developers, designers, and digital specialists to deliver high-quality websites while building the knowledge and skills required for a career in software development.

Responsibilities:

  • Assist in developing and maintaining WordPress websites and digital platforms
  • Support the creation and customization of WordPress themes and templates
  • Implement responsive designs using HTML and CSS frameworks such as Bootstrap
  • Learn to write and modify PHP code within the WordPress environment
  • Assist with installing, configuring, and maintaining WordPress plugins
  • Support troubleshooting and debugging website issues
  • Test websites across different browsers and devices
  • Help optimise websites for performance, accessibility, and user experience
  • Work collaboratively with designers, developers, and content teams
  • Follow coding standards, documentation practices, and version control processes

During the apprenticeship, you will develop skills in:

  • Front-end development (HTML, CSS, responsive design)
  • Backend development fundamentals using PHP
  • WordPress theme and plugin development
  • Version control using Git
  • Software testing and debugging
  • Website performance optimisation
  • Secure development practices
  • Agile development methodologies
  • Documentation and technical communication

Successful apprentices will demonstrate:

  • Enthusiasm for learning new technologies
  • Strong problem-solving mindset
  • Attention to detail
  • Good communication and teamwork skills
  • Ability to manage time and complete tasks with support
  • Willingness to take feedback and continuously improve

Applicants should demonstrate an interest in software development and some foundational knowledge of web technologies.

Helpful experience includes:

  • Basic understanding of HTML and CSS
  • Familiarity with WordPress or other CMS platforms
  • Basic understanding of responsive web design
  • Interest in learning PHP and backend development
  • Some exposure to JavaScript
  • Awareness of how websites are structured and deployed

Formal experience is not required, but personal projects, coursework, or self-learning are highly valued.

Entry requirements:

  • The learner must have completed a Level 3 Software Development Apprenticeship with QA or have an equivalent qualification with another training provider
  • OR an A-level in Science, Technology, Engineering or Mathematics (STEM) subject and a successful completion of our aptitude test
  • OR a BTEC Diploma in IT and a successful completion of our aptitude test
  • OR 2 years’ experience in a relevant role and successful completion of our aptitude test

You may also have a combination of qualifications and experience which demonstrate the minimum foundation needed for the programme. In this instance you could still be considered for the programme.

If you hold international equivalents of the above qualifications, at the time of your application you must be able to provide an official document that states how your international qualifications compare to the UK qualifications.

For more information please visit the UK ENIC website. 

Working hours: Monday to Friday, 9am - 5:30pm

Benefits:

  • A fully funded Level 4 Software Developer Apprenticeship
  • Mentoring from experienced developers
  • Real project experience working on client websites
  • A supportive and collaborative working environment
  • Opportunities to build a strong professional portfolio
  • Clear career progression into a Junior Developer role upon successful completion

Future prospects:

90% of QA apprentices secure permanent employment after completing: this is 20% higher than the national average.

About QA:

Our apprenticeships are the perfect way to gain new skills, earn while you learn, and launch yourself into an exciting future. With over 50,000 successful apprenticeship graduates, we're a top 50 training provider, dedicated to helping you succeed.

Interested? Apply now!

Please be advised that this advert may close prior to the closing date stated above if a high number of applications are received. If you are interested in this vacancy please apply below as soon as possible.

Job Details

Company
QA
Location
Team Valley Trading Estate, Gateshead, Tyne and Wear, England, United Kingdom
Employment Type
Full-Time
Salary
£20,000 per annum
Posted